Very Easy installation - Yamaha Drive 2
Replaced a set of Trojan batteries in a Yamaha Drive 2. We could get one drive around the neighborhood and they would die. Packaging was perfect. All parts needed were included in the kit except for some wood screws for this specific installation method, see below. There was a noticeable increase in acceleration but not any increase in speed. After spending twice as much time as we could get out of driving with the old batteries, there was still 83% left on this beast. I like the fact that this battery has an on off switch to keep any drain on the battery from happening when not in use. The gauge works well. One thing I noticed is that if you keep the battery switch on you can switch the battery off from the gauge on screen 2. I heard the relay that controls the power switch kick on and off when the screen button was pressed. Lots of good information on the gauge. It reminds me of the gas mileage calculator in my vehicle. It shows you how much time you have left on the battery based on the current consumption. For instance it shows a massive drain when you are accelerating but drops back significantly when you are up to speed. The only thing that I found that could have been better is the hole that the screen mounts to could have been slightly smaller to hold the screen tighter but after mounting the bracket to the cart it seemed to hold ok. BTW the cord that comes with the monitor screen is super long. See how much is rolled up in the pics. I chose to install the charger in the cart just make the indicator that it is charging viewable. I think you need to turn the battery on the first time you charge it. Overall I am very pleased with this installation. I liked that this battery case has the flange on the bottom to mount the battery in the cart instead of a strap. As far as how long it lasts, we will see. Yes there are cheaper batteries out there, I chose this one based on the other reviews and the way the case was made. A tip on the Yamaha Drive 2 installation. Get a Multitool with any flat blade and a small piece of 1x4, lay the piece of wood down next to the plastic ribs at the bottom of the battery tray and cut the rib down to 3/4 inch. This allows you to use a piece of 3/4 plywood as the base and have a nice even surface to set the battery and charger on to while maintaining some strength in the battery tray.
